In a special ceremony yesterday, Bardem - who is both unconventionally and undeniably attractive - was joined by the Skyfall Bond girls and director Sam Mendes to mark the occassion. Commenting on the special honour, Bardem said: "It's too soon for me... But it's a great honour to receive it. I grew up in a family of filmmakers and actors dating back, back, back to the earliest days of Spanish cinema... And I've been lucky enough to work as a professional actor for 25 years."

Passing remark on the actor's accolade, Skyfall director Sam Mendes said: "For me, he's part of the great tradition that includes Brando and Burton. He's our Brando and our Burton for this generation.He's hating this, it's making him very embarrassed. Even though he's a great actor, I suspect he would not describe himself as an actor first. Because first he's also a husband and a father."
